Dentures


What is a Denture?

A denture is a removable replacement for missing teeth and adjacent tissues. It is made of acrylic resin, sometimes in combination with various metals. Complete dentures replace all the teeth, while a partial denture fills in the spaces created by missing teeth and prevents other teeth from changing their position.

Are Dentures a good possibility for you?

Candidates for complete dentures have lost most or all of their teeth. A partial denture is suitable for those who have some natural teeth remaining. A well-made denture improves chewing ability and speech, and provides support for facial muscles. It will greatly enhance the facial appearance and smile.

What can you expect with the Denture process?

A full conventional denture is constructed when all teeth have been lost or all extraction sites have healed sufficiently to take impressions (up to eight weeks or longer.) The denture process takes a series of three or four appointments for fabrication and in as little time as one week. Instructions will be given on the specific routine of care that will keep your Dentures looking well.
